7th Street live-music dive — bands, drag, and karaoke with a queer crowd
Que Sera is a live-music dive bar on 7th Street that runs house and disco nights, punk and metal shows, indie bands, drag, comedy, and karaoke. The crowd is mixed and inclusive, with regular queer nights. Cash-only with an ATM on site.
